        "content": "Here\u2019s what I found out about the **highest-end NVIDIA GPU** that Lenovo ThinkSystem **ST550** officially supports, along with relevant limitations. If you tell me whether yours has the *original chassis* or the *new chassis*, I can help you narrow it further.\n\n---\n\n## What Lenovo Says\n\nFrom official Lenovo documentation, the ST550 supports several classes of NVIDIA GPUs, with the most capable being:\n\n- **NVIDIA P6000** \u2014 full-height, full-length, **double-slot** GPU ([pubs.lenovo.com](https://pubs.lenovo.com/st550/server_specifications?utm_source=openai))  \n- **NVIDIA P4000** and **RTX4000** \u2014 full-height, full-length, **single-slot** GPUs (but *only in the new chassis*) ([pubs.lenovo.com](https://pubs.lenovo.com/st550/server_specifications?utm_source=openai))  \n\nThe documents also note that the ST550 can support up to **two graphics adapters** simultaneously, although there are thermal, power, and cooling prerequisites. ([pubs.lenovo.com](https://pubs.lenovo.com/st550/server_specifications?utm_source=openai))\n\n---\n\n## Key Requirements & Constraints\n\nTo support those maximum GPUs (especially the P6000), your system must meet certain conditions:\n\n1. **Power Supply (PSU):**  \n   You must have **two 1100-watt AC power supplies** installed. These are high-capacity units to support the GPU\u2019s power draw. ([pubs.lenovo.com](https://pubs.lenovo.com/st550/server_specifications?utm_source=openai))\n\n2. **Chassis Type:**  \n   - **Original chassis** (older design) does **not** support the P4000 or RTX4000 in full-height, full-length single-slot form. ([pubs.lenovo.com](https://pubs.lenovo.com/st550/zh-CN/server_specifications?utm_source=openai))  \n   - **New chassis** (lenovo part numbers SC87A19892 or SC87A19894) supports those newer Form Factor V3.0 GPUs like P4000 & RTX4000. ([pubs.lenovo.com](https://pubs.lenovo.com/st550/zh-CN/server_specifications?utm_source=openai))\n\n3. **Cooling / Fans:**  \n   - Fan 4 (the rear redundant fan) must be installed.  \n   - Operating temperature caps: below **35 \u00b0C (95 \u00b0F)** when one P6000 is installed; below **30 \u00b0C (86 \u00b0F)** if two are installed. For other supported GPUs, 35 \u00b0C is the limit with one or two cards. ([pubs.lenovo.com](https://pubs.lenovo.com/st550/server_specifications?utm_source=openai))\n\n4. **PCI-Express Slot Availability:**  \n   - Slot 3 (and slot 5 if a second CPU is installed) are the ones that support *double-wide* GPUs. ([lenovopress.lenovo.com](https://lenovopress.lenovo.com/lp1055-thinksystem-st550-server-xeon-sp-gen-2?utm_source=openai))  \n   - Installing a double-wide GPU in these slots makes adjacent slots unavailable due to physical space. ([lenovopress.lenovo.com](https://lenovopress.lenovo.com/lp1055-thinksystem-st550-server-xeon-sp-gen-2?utm_source=openai))  \n\n5. **TDP Limit:**  \n   All officially supported GPUs must be within **250 watts** TDP. ([pubs.lenovo.com](https://pubs.lenovo.com/st550/server_specifications?utm_source=openai))  \n\n---\n\n## What This Means for \u201cHighest-End\u201d GPU\n\nGiven all constraints:\n\n- The **NVIDIA P6000** is the top officially supported card, being double-slot and full-height/length. If your ST550 meets the PSU, cooling, and temperature requirements, that\u2019s the peak. ([pubs.lenovo.com](https://pubs.lenovo.com/st550/server_specifications?utm_source=openai))  \n- If you have the **new chassis**, the P4000 or RTX4000 are also options (still very high performance) with somewhat less power/thermal demand than the P6000. ([pubs.lenovo.com](https://pubs.lenovo.com/st550/zh-CN/server_specifications?utm_source=openai))  \n\n---\n\n## Caveats & What Is *Not* Supported\n\n- Modern GeForce RTX 30/40-series, or newer architecture NVIDIA GPUs (e.g. Ampere, Ada Lovelace) are *not listed* among supported GPUs in Lenovo\u2019s compatibility docs.
